By now, everyone knew that this handsome man was here to find Josephine, but she was actually sleeping during work hours. To not let her continue to be embarrassed, Wren kindly poked her with a pen.

Josephine was happily riding unicorns in her dream when she felt someone touching her arm. So, she muttered in her sleep, “What?” “Joey, wake up.” Wren tried harder to wake her up.

Only when Josephine heard Wren’s voice did she realize that she wasn’t at home but at work. She quickly opened her eyes, her long eyelashes fluttering like butterfly wings, and she woke up instantly. Then, she sensed that someone was standing in front of her desk, so she looked up in shock.

As soon as she saw the man, she was petrified and wished she could bury herself in a hole. F*ck! When did Ethan come? And he’s standing right in front of me. Did I drool? She quickly wiped her mouth, thankfully finding nothing. “Why are you here, Mr. Quarles?” While blushing, she stood up but didn’t dare look at him.

With a smile, Ethan answered, “No reason. I just wanted to see you.” His low and husky voice sounded like a professional voice actor. “Are you done with your meeting?” She finally looked at him, meeting his deep and mesmerizing eyes, which made her face even hotter. “Not yet.” After saying that, he flipped through the documents on her desk and asked, “Are you not busy?”

At this moment, her face was burning. I am busy! Busy sleeping! “Here you are, Mr. Quarles! Mr. Kowalski sent me to look for you.” Atticus’ assistant came downstairs to find Ethan. “Okay,” Ethan replied before turning to Josephine. “I’ll go upstairs first.”

“Okay, take care,” Josephine answered and watched him leave. As soon as he left, five to six faces gathered around her desk, all clamoring to ask, “Who is he, Josephine?”
